Occidental Petroleum (NYSE:OXY) shares fell 0.7% to $49.97, with trading volume down 67% from average levels. Analysts have adjusted price targets, with Evercore ISI lowering theirs from $67 to $63, while Wells Fargo cut theirs from $56 to $53. The stock has a consensus rating of "Hold" and a price target of $62.19. The company recently announced a quarterly dividend of $0.22. Major shareholder Berkshire Hathaway acquired over 3.6 million shares, increasing their stake by 1.39%. Institutional investors hold 88.70% of the stock.
